Dear all,
Compared to Skype, it is much more difficult to 'send text message' while
in a call with someone. The trouble is that to send a text message the
contact being called needs to be in the Addressbook, which is not always
necessarily the case.
To address this issue I would suggest two UI elements:
- In the Call tab (while during a call with someone), add a 'send text
message' button that would allow to send a message to the contact that is
currently being called.
- In the Recent calls tab add a context-menu similar to the one in the
Contacts tab. It should allow to (1) Call address@hidden, (2) Send text
to address@hidden and (3) Add address@hidden to Contacts.
Both suggestions above would streamline and improve the UI. Regards,
